Understanding the Level 3 Advisory
On October 31, the State Department elevated its advisory for Tanzania from Level 2 to Level 3, urging travelers to “reconsider travel” due to increased risks of crime, unrest, and potential violence. This advisory highlights several concerns less familiar to those considering their bucket-list vacations. Among these are significant warnings regarding escalating demonstrations following Tanzanian elections, which have triggered riots and clashes in various parts of the country.
According to the advisory, “demonstrations can be unpredictable,” leading to increased security measures deployed by the Tanzanian government. This alert is particularly important for anyone unfamiliar with the terrain or political climate, highlighting the need for vigilance when traveling abroad.
Terrorism and Crime: What Travelers Should Know
The advisory doesn’t shy away from mentioning the risk of terrorism, which notably spikes in regions such as Mtwara. Travelers may not realize that such violence could involve direct targeting of visitors, adding stress to what should otherwise be a joyful exploration of Tanzania’s wildlife and landscapes.
Furthermore, violent crimes such as robbery and sexual assaults are acknowledged as common occurrences. Impact on the LGBTQ+ Community
For members of the LGBTQ+ community planning to visit Tanzania, the advisory details specific risks including potential targeting and harassment by local authorities. Those who identify as gay or lesbian must be particularly vigilant, as harassment can escalate rapidly. Travel Trends Amidst Warnings
Despite the advisory, over 2 million people visited Tanzania in 2024 alone, as reported by the Tanzania National Bureau of Statistics.
